Haus Welbergen is a historic moated castle nestled in the picturesque Münsterland region of North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any. Located in Welbergen, a district of Ochtrup, this enchanting Wasserburg sits at an elevation of 48 meters above sea level. Its unique design, featuring an outer and a main castle entirely surrounded by water, makes it a prominent landmark and a cherished stop along the popular 100 Castles Route.

    Can I visit the interior of the main castle building?

    The interior of the main baroque manor house at Haus Welbergen is typically not open for general public access. It is primarily used for conferences and international meetings. Access is usually limited to special guided tours or events. However, the courtyards, gardens, and the exterior architecture are freely accessible and offer plenty to explore.

    Are there any specific viewpoints or natural features to look out for?

    Absolutely! Beyond the stunning moated castle itself, look for the meticulously maintained gardens, especially when roses and perennials are in bloom. The estate also boasts ancient trees, some designated as natural monuments, including a mighty plane tree, a large yew, and a gnarled sweet chestnut. Don't miss the historic pavilion in the orchard and the old water mill dating back to 1802, located northeast of the main castle.
